A student measures the time period of a simple pendulum 4 times. The mean time period is calculated to be 2.00 s . If three of the recorded readings are 1.98 s , 1.99 s , and 2.02 s , what is the percentage relative error of the measurements?

Options

  1. A3.0 %
  2. B0.625 %
  3. C0.83 %
  4. D0.75 %

Correct answer

D. 0.75 %

Step-by-step solution

First, find the fourth reading. The mean of 4 readings is 2.00 s , so their sum is 4 2.00 = 8.00 s . The sum of the three given readings is 1.98 + 1.99 + 2.02 = 5.99 s . Therefore, the fourth reading is 8.00 - 5.99 = 2.01 s .
